Franchisee Lease Payments definition

Franchisee Lease Payments means all lease payments, taxes and any other amounts payable by Franchisees to a Franchise Entity in respect of Real Estate Assets.
Franchisee Lease Payments means all lease payments, taxes and any other amounts payable by Franchisees to a Guarantor in respect of Real Estate Assets and New Real Estate Assets.
Franchisee Lease Payments means the rental payments and any other amounts paid by any franchisee pursuant to any Refranchised Restaurant Lease or Franchisee Sub-Lease.

Examples of Franchisee Lease Payments in a sentence

  • Franchisee Lease Payments that have been deposited into a Concentration Account shall be transferred to the Lease Obligations Account on or before the second (2nd) Business Day following the last day of each Interim Collection Period.

  • All Franchisee Lease Payments received by Planet Fitness Assetco shall be deposited as soon as practicable, and in any event within three (3) Business Days of receipt into the applicable Concentration Account or the Lease Obligations Accounts (unless such deposit requires an international funds transfer, in which case such funds shall be deposited to the applicable Concentration Account or the Lease Obligations Account within five (5) Business Days of receipt).

  • Until the Indenture is terminated pursuant to Section 12.1, the Master Issuer shall cause all Franchisee Lease Payments deposited into the U.S. Concentration Account to be deposited to the Real Estate Obligations Account on or before the fifth (5th) Business Day following the last day of each Weekly Collection Period.

  • Each Lease Obligations Advance will be repaid solely from Franchisee Lease Payments received in the Lease Obligations Account after the date of such Lease Obligations Advance.

  • Each Real Estate Holder Advance shall be repaid solely from Franchisee Lease Payments received in the Real Estate Obligations Account after the date of such Real Estate Holder Advance in accordance with Section 5.10(d) of the Base Indenture.

  • On and after the Series 2024-1 Springing Amendments Implementation Date, in the event that sufficient funds are not available in the Lease Obligations Account to pay any Lease Obligations at any time, the Manager may make an advance (a “Lease Obligations Advance”) to fund such payment to the extent it reasonably expects to be reimbursed for such advances from the proceeds of future Franchisee Lease Payments, it being agreed that any such advances shall not constitute Manager Advances.
